Handing off the color-contrast audit for Petalforge ahead of the weekly sync. I've finished scanning the dashboard and settings views; 14 components fail the 4.5:1 threshold, mostly muted text on the sage background. The chart legends are the trickiest — Tamsin proposed darkening the palette rather than adding outlines, and I agree. Remaining work: modal footers and the empty-state illustrations. All findings, screenshots, and proposed token changes are tracked in the audit spreadsheet linked from our internal page.

runbook for bahif-tagep: https://jira.tolvaqsys.internal/pages/pages/browse/f7e35550

Handover: Exportron retry queue

Hi Mira — handing over the failed-export retries. Exports that hit a timeout land in the retry queue and get three attempts with backoff; after that they're parked and need a manual requeue from the admin panel. Watch for customers reporting duplicates — that usually means a double requeue. The current retry settings are as follows.

settings of bajog-fawig:
oliael:
  log_level: warn
  metrics_host: metrics.oliael.zemvarsys.internal
  pin: 0267
  pool_size: 32

Handover — Quillbrook catalogue import, from Soren to Ida. Importer pulls MARC dumps from the Larchfield consortium nightly; dedupe runs after, keyed on normalized title plus year. Known issue: diacritics in author names break the matcher — patch is in review, please look at the fold-case branch first. Staging DB was rebuilt Monday, so counts will look low until Friday. The importer's service account locks after failed batch retries; if that happens during your review, restore it with the recovery passphrase below.

unlock words, hahip-baduf: holwyn-istath-julvan

Ticket: Retention sweeper sign-off needed. The Dustbin sweeper for Project Larkmoor now hard-deletes records older than 400 days from the archive tier. I verified the dry-run output against the staging snapshot and confirmed tombstones are written before purge. Please review the batch-size guard and the rollback plan in the attached notes before approving. Sign-off must come from the engineer accountable for retention policy.

account owner for fajep-yagef: Kasix Eliiel